==> Synchronizing chroot copy [/home/leming/armv8/root] -> [leming]...done
==> Making package: dracut 108-1 (Mon Aug 4 07:24:05 2025)
==> Retrieving sources...
-> Cloning dracut-108 git repo...
Cloning into bare repository '/home/leming/work/dracut/dracut-108'...
-> Found dracut-install.script
-> Found dracut-remove.script
-> Found 90-dracut-install.hook
-> Found 60-dracut-remove.hook
==> WARNING: Skipping verification of source file PGP signatures.
==> Validating source files with sha512sums...
dracut-108 ... Skipped
dracut-install.script ... Passed
dracut-remove.script ... Passed
90-dracut-install.hook ... Passed
60-dracut-remove.hook ... Passed
==> Validating source files with b2sums...
dracut-108 ... Skipped
dracut-install.script ... Passed
dracut-remove.script ... Passed
90-dracut-install.hook ... Passed
60-dracut-remove.hook ... Passed
==> Making package: dracut 108-1 (Mon Aug 4 07:24:14 2025)
==> Checking runtime dependencies...
==> Installing missing dependencies...
[?25lresolving dependencies...
looking for conflicting packages...
Packages (2) cpio-2.15-3 procps-ng-4.0.5-3
Total Download Size: 0.21 MiB
Total Installed Size: 4.23 MiB
:: Proceed with installation? [Y/n]
:: Retrieving packages...
cpio-2.15-3-aarch64 downloading...
checking keyring...
checking package integrity...
loading package files...
checking for file conflicts...
checking available disk space...
:: Processing package changes...
installing cpio...
installing procps-ng...
:: Running post-transaction hooks...
(1/2) Arming ConditionNeedsUpdate...
(2/2) Updating the info directory file...
[?25h==> Checking buildtime dependencies...
==> Installing missing dependencies...
[?25lresolving dependencies...
looking for conflicting packages...
warning: dependency cycle detected:
warning: rubygems will be installed before its ruby dependency
Packages (13) libedit-20250104_3.1-1 libyaml-0.2.5-3 llvm-libs-20.1.8-1
perl-error-0.17030-2 perl-mailtools-2.22-2 perl-timedate-2.33-8
ruby-3.4.4-2 rubygems-3.6.7-2 zlib-ng-2.2.4-1
asciidoctor-2.0.23-8 bash-completion-2.16.0-1 git-2.50.1-3
rust-1:1.88.0-1
Total Download Size: 4.74 MiB
Total Installed Size: 429.98 MiB
:: Proceed with installation? [Y/n]
:: Retrieving packages...
ruby-3.4.4-2-aarch64 downloading...
rubygems-3.6.7-2-any downloading...
asciidoctor-2.0.23-8-any downloading...
bash-completion-2.16.0-1-any downloading...
checking keyring...
checking package integrity...
loading package files...
checking for file conflicts...
checking available disk space...
:: Processing package changes...
installing libyaml...
installing rubygems...
installing ruby...
Optional dependencies for ruby
tk: for Ruby/TK
ruby-docs: Documentation for Ruby
ruby-default-gems: Default gems which are part of Ruby StdLib
ruby-bundled-gems: Bundled gems which are part of Ruby StdLib
ruby-stdlib: Full Ruby StdLib including default gems, bundled gems and tools
installing asciidoctor...
installing bash-completion...
installing perl-error...
installing perl-timedate...
installing perl-mailtools...
installing zlib-ng...
installing git...
Optional dependencies for git
git-zsh-completion: upstream zsh completion
tk: gitk and git gui
openssh: ssh transport and crypto
man: show help with `git command --help`
perl-libwww: git svn
perl-term-readkey: git svn and interactive.singlekey setting
perl-io-socket-ssl: git send-email TLS support
perl-authen-sasl: git send-email TLS support
perl-mediawiki-api: git mediawiki support
perl-datetime-format-iso8601: git mediawiki support
perl-lwp-protocol-https: git mediawiki https support
perl-cgi: gitweb (web interface) support
python: git svn & git p4 [installed]
subversion: git svn
org.freedesktop.secrets: keyring credential helper
libsecret: libsecret credential helper [installed]
less: the default pager for git [installed]
installing libedit...
installing llvm-libs...
installing rust...
Optional dependencies for rust
gdb: rust-gdb script
lldb: rust-lldb script
:: Running post-transaction hooks...
(1/4) Creating system user accounts...
Creating group 'git' with GID 971.
Creating user 'git' (git daemon user) with UID 971 and GID 971.
(2/4) Reloading system manager configuration...
Skipped: Current root is not booted.
(3/4) Arming ConditionNeedsUpdate...
(4/4) Checking for old perl modules...
[?25h==> Retrieving sources...
-> Found dracut-install.script
-> Found dracut-remove.script
-> Found 90-dracut-install.hook
-> Found 60-dracut-remove.hook
==> WARNING: Skipping all source file integrity checks.
==> Extracting sources...
-> Creating working copy of dracut-108 git repo...
Cloning into 'dracut-108'...
done.
Switched to a new branch 'makepkg'
==> Starting build()...
cc -c -march=armv8-a -O2 -pipe -fno-plt -fexceptions -Wp,-D_FORTIFY_SOURCE=3 -Wformat -Werror=format-security -fstack-clash-protection -DCONFIG_WEAKDEP -DHAVE_SYSTEMD src/install/dracut-install.c -o src/install/dracut-install.o
cc -c -march=armv8-a -O2 -pipe -fno-plt -fexceptions -Wp,-D_FORTIFY_SOURCE=3 -Wformat -Werror=format-security -fstack-clash-protection -DCONFIG_WEAKDEP -DHAVE_SYSTEMD src/install/hashmap.c -o src/install/hashmap.o
cc -c -march=armv8-a -O2 -pipe -fno-plt -fexceptions -Wp,-D_FORTIFY_SOURCE=3 -Wformat -Werror=format-security -fstack-clash-protection -DCONFIG_WEAKDEP -DHAVE_SYSTEMD src/install/log.c -o src/install/log.o
cc -c -march=armv8-a -O2 -pipe -fno-plt -fexceptions -Wp,-D_FORTIFY_SOURCE=3 -Wformat -Werror=format-security -fstack-clash-protection -DCONFIG_WEAKDEP -DHAVE_SYSTEMD src/install/strv.c -o src/install/strv.o
cc -c -march=armv8-a -O2 -pipe -fno-plt -fexceptions -Wp,-D_FORTIFY_SOURCE=3 -Wformat -Werror=format-security -fstack-clash-protection -DCONFIG_WEAKDEP -DHAVE_SYSTEMD src/install/util.c -o src/install/util.o
cc -march=armv8-a -O2 -pipe -fno-plt -fexceptions -Wp,-D_FORTIFY_SOURCE=3 -Wformat -Werror=format-security -fstack-clash-protection -Wl,-O1 -Wl,--sort-common -Wl,--as-needed -Wl,-z,relro -Wl,-z,now src/skipcpio/skipcpio.c -o src/skipcpio/skipcpio
cc -march=armv8-a -O2 -pipe -fno-plt -fexceptions -Wp,-D_FORTIFY_SOURCE=3 -Wformat -Werror=format-security -fstack-clash-protection -Wl,-O1 -Wl,--sort-common -Wl,--as-needed -Wl,-z,relro -Wl,-z,now src/util/util.c -o src/util/util
cargo --offline build --release --manifest-path src/dracut-cpio/Cargo.toml
asciidoctor -a "version=108" -b manpage man/lsinitrd.1.adoc
Compiling crosvm v0.1.0 (/build/dracut/src/dracut-108/src/dracut-cpio/third_party/crosvm)
Building [ ] 0/2: crosvm
asciidoctor -a "version=108" -b manpage man/dracut.conf.5.adoc
asciidoctor -a "version=108" -b manpage man/dracut.cmdline.7.adoc
asciidoctor -a "version=108" -b manpage man/dracut.bootup.7.adoc
asciidoctor -a "version=108" -b manpage man/dracut.modules.7.adoc
Compiling dracut-cpio v0.1.0 (/build/dracut/src/dracut-108/src/dracut-cpio)
Building [=============> ] 1/2: dracut-cpio(bin)
asciidoctor -a "version=108" -b manpage man/dracut.8.adoc
asciidoctor -a "version=108" -b manpage man/dracut-catimages.8.adoc
asciidoctor -a "version=108" -b manpage modules.d/77dracut-systemd/dracut-cmdline.service.8.adoc
asciidoctor -a "version=108" -b manpage modules.d/77dracut-systemd/dracut-mount.service.8.adoc
asciidoctor -a "version=108" -b manpage modules.d/77dracut-systemd/dracut-shutdown.service.8.adoc
asciidoctor -a "version=108" -b manpage modules.d/77dracut-systemd/dracut-pre-mount.service.8.adoc
asciidoctor -a "version=108" -b manpage modules.d/77dracut-systemd/dracut-pre-pivot.service.8.adoc
asciidoctor -a "version=108" -b manpage modules.d/77dracut-systemd/dracut-pre-trigger.service.8.adoc
asciidoctor -a "version=108" -b manpage modules.d/77dracut-systemd/dracut-pre-udev.service.8.adoc
asciidoctor -a "version=108" -b manpage modules.d/77initqueue/dracut-initqueue.service.8.adoc
cc -Wl,-O1 -Wl,--sort-common -Wl,--as-needed -Wl,-z,relro -Wl,-z,now -o src/install/dracut-install src/install/dracut-install.o src/install/hashmap.o src/install/log.o src/install/strv.o src/install/util.o -lc -lkmod -lsystemd
cp -a src/util/util dracut-util
ln -fs src/install/dracut-install dracut-install
Finished `release` profile [optimized] target(s) in 3.28s
ln -fs src/dracut-cpio/target/release/dracut-cpio dracut-cpio
==> Entering fakeroot environment...
==> Starting package()...
mkdir -p /build/dracut/pkg/dracut/usr/lib/dracut
mkdir -p /build/dracut/pkg/dracut/usr/bin
mkdir -p /build/dracut/pkg/dracut/etc
mkdir -p /build/dracut/pkg/dracut/usr/lib/dracut/modules.d
mkdir -p /build/dracut/pkg/dracut/usr/share/man/man1 /build/dracut/pkg/dracut/usr/share/man/man5 /build/dracut/pkg/dracut/usr/share/man/man7 /build/dracut/pkg/dracut/usr/share/man/man8
install -m 0755 dracut.sh /build/dracut/pkg/dracut/usr/bin/dracut
install -m 0755 dracut-catimages.sh /build/dracut/pkg/dracut/usr/bin/dracut-catimages
install -m 0755 lsinitrd.sh /build/dracut/pkg/dracut/usr/bin/lsinitrd
install -m 0644 dracut.conf /build/dracut/pkg/dracut/etc/dracut.conf
mkdir -p /build/dracut/pkg/dracut/etc/dracut.conf.d
mkdir -p /build/dracut/pkg/dracut/usr/lib/dracut/dracut.conf.d
install -m 0755 dracut-init.sh /build/dracut/pkg/dracut/usr/lib/dracut/dracut-init.sh
install -m 0755 dracut-functions.sh /build/dracut/pkg/dracut/usr/lib/dracut/dracut-functions.sh
install -m 0755 dracut-version.sh /build/dracut/pkg/dracut/usr/lib/dracut/dracut-version.sh
ln -fs dracut-functions.sh /build/dracut/pkg/dracut/usr/lib/dracut/dracut-functions
install -m 0755 dracut-logger.sh /build/dracut/pkg/dracut/usr/lib/dracut/dracut-logger.sh
install -m 0755 dracut-initramfs-restore.sh /build/dracut/pkg/dracut/usr/lib/dracut/dracut-initramfs-restore
cp -arx modules.d /build/dracut/pkg/dracut/usr/lib/dracut
for conf in fips/10-fips.conf generic/11-generic.conf hostonly/10-hostonly.conf ima/10-ima.conf no-network/10-no-network.conf no-xattr/10-no-xattr.conf rescue/10-rescue.conf uki-virt/10-uki-virt.conf ; do \
install -D -m 0644 "dracut.conf.d/$conf" "/build/dracut/pkg/dracut/usr/lib/dracut/dracut.conf.d/$conf"; \
done
for i in hostonly ; do \
cp -arx dracut.conf.d/$i/* /build/dracut/pkg/dracut/usr/lib/dracut/dracut.conf.d/ ;\
done
rm -rf /build/dracut/pkg/dracut/usr/lib/dracut/modules.d/70test*
for i in man/lsinitrd.1; do install -m 0644 $i /build/dracut/pkg/dracut/usr/share/man/man1/${i##*/}; done
for i in man/dracut.conf.5; do install -m 0644 $i /build/dracut/pkg/dracut/usr/share/man/man5/${i##*/}; done
for i in man/dracut.cmdline.7 man/dracut.bootup.7 man/dracut.modules.7; do install -m 0644 $i /build/dracut/pkg/dracut/usr/share/man/man7/${i##*/}; done
for i in man/dracut.8 man/dracut-catimages.8 modules.d/77dracut-systemd/dracut-cmdline.service.8 modules.d/77dracut-systemd/dracut-mount.service.8 modules.d/77dracut-systemd/dracut-shutdown.service.8 modules.d/77dracut-systemd/dracut-pre-mount.service.8 modules.d/77dracut-systemd/dracut-pre-pivot.service.8 modules.d/77dracut-systemd/dracut-pre-trigger.service.8 modules.d/77dracut-systemd/dracut-pre-udev.service.8 modules.d/77initqueue/dracut-initqueue.service.8; do install -m 0644 $i /build/dracut/pkg/dracut/usr/share/man/man8/${i##*/}; done
ln -fs dracut.cmdline.7 /build/dracut/pkg/dracut/usr/share/man/man7/dracut.kernel.7
if [ -n "/usr/lib/systemd/system" ]; then \
mkdir -p /build/dracut/pkg/dracut/usr/lib/systemd/system; \
ln -srf /build/dracut/pkg/dracut/usr/lib/dracut/modules.d/77dracut-systemd/dracut-shutdown-onfailure.service /build/dracut/pkg/dracut/usr/lib/systemd/system/dracut-shutdown-onfailure.service; \
ln -srf /build/dracut/pkg/dracut/usr/lib/dracut/modules.d/77dracut-systemd/dracut-shutdown.service /build/dracut/pkg/dracut/usr/lib/systemd/system/dracut-shutdown.service; \
mkdir -p /build/dracut/pkg/dracut/usr/lib/systemd/system/sysinit.target.wants; \
ln -sf ../dracut-shutdown.service \
/build/dracut/pkg/dracut/usr/lib/systemd/system/sysinit.target.wants/dracut-shutdown.service; \
mkdir -p /build/dracut/pkg/dracut/usr/lib/systemd/system/initrd.target.wants; \
for i in \
dracut-cmdline.service \
dracut-mount.service \
dracut-pre-mount.service \
dracut-pre-pivot.service \
dracut-pre-trigger.service \
dracut-pre-udev.service \
; do \
ln -srf /build/dracut/pkg/dracut/usr/lib/dracut/modules.d/77dracut-systemd/$i /build/dracut/pkg/dracut/usr/lib/systemd/system; \
ln -sf ../$i \
/build/dracut/pkg/dracut/usr/lib/systemd/system/initrd.target.wants/$i; \
done; \
ln -srf /build/dracut/pkg/dracut/usr/lib/dracut/modules.d/77initqueue/dracut-initqueue.service /build/dracut/pkg/dracut/usr/lib/systemd/system; \
ln -sf ../dracut-initqueue.service \
/build/dracut/pkg/dracut/usr/lib/systemd/system/initrd.target.wants/dracut-initqueue.service; \
fi
if [ -f src/install/dracut-install ]; then \
install -m 0755 src/install/dracut-install /build/dracut/pkg/dracut/usr/lib/dracut/dracut-install; \
fi
if [ -f src/skipcpio/skipcpio ]; then \
install -m 0755 src/skipcpio/skipcpio /build/dracut/pkg/dracut/usr/lib/dracut/skipcpio; \
fi
if [ -f dracut-util ]; then \
install -m 0755 dracut-util /build/dracut/pkg/dracut/usr/lib/dracut/dracut-util; \
fi
install -m 0755 dracut-cpio /build/dracut/pkg/dracut/usr/lib/dracut/dracut-cpio
mkdir -p /build/dracut/pkg/dracut/usr/lib/kernel/install.d
install -m 0755 install.d/50-dracut.install /build/dracut/pkg/dracut/usr/lib/kernel/install.d/50-dracut.install
install -m 0755 install.d/51-dracut-rescue.install /build/dracut/pkg/dracut/usr/lib/kernel/install.d/51-dracut-rescue.install
mkdir -p /build/dracut/pkg/dracut/usr/share/bash-completion/completions
install -m 0644 shell-completion/bash/dracut /build/dracut/pkg/dracut/usr/share/bash-completion/completions/dracut
install -m 0644 shell-completion/bash/lsinitrd /build/dracut/pkg/dracut/usr/share/bash-completion/completions/lsinitrd
mkdir -p /build/dracut/pkg/dracut/usr/share/pkgconfig
install -m 0644 dracut.pc /build/dracut/pkg/dracut/usr/share/pkgconfig/dracut.pc
if ! [ -n "/usr/lib/systemd/system" ]; then \
rm -rf /build/dracut/pkg/dracut/usr/lib/dracut/test/TEST-[0-9][0-9]-*SYSTEMD* ;\
rm -rf /build/dracut/pkg/dracut/usr/lib/dracut/modules.d/*systemd* /build/dracut/pkg/dracut/usr/share/man/*.service.* ; \
for i in bluetooth connman dbus* fido2 lvmmerge lvmthinpool-monitor memstrack pcsc pkcs11 rngd squash* tpm2-tss; do \
rm -rf /build/dracut/pkg/dracut/usr/lib/dracut/modules.d/[0-9][0-9]${i}; \
done \
fi
==> Tidying install...
-> Removing libtool files...
-> Purging unwanted files...
-> Removing static library files...
-> Stripping unneeded symbols from binaries and libraries...
-> Compressing man and info pages...
==> Checking for packaging issues...
==> WARNING: Package contains reference to $srcdir
usr/lib/dracut/dracut-cpio
==> Creating package "dracut"...
-> Generating .PKGINFO file...
-> Generating .BUILDINFO file...
-> Generating .MTREE file...
-> Compressing package...
==> Leaving fakeroot environment.
==> Finished making: dracut 108-1 (Mon Aug 4 07:24:45 2025)
==> Cleaning up...